this box can be packed with 48 unit cubes. The edge length of each unit cube is 1 meter. What is the volume of the box?

Answer:

48 m^3

Step-by-step explanation:

along the length = 8 cubes = 8 m

breadth = 3 cubes = 3 m

height = 2 cubes = 2 m

volume = 48 m^3

Identify the zeros of the polynomial function N(x)=1/2 (x-1)(x+3).

Answer:

a:x=-3

c:x=1

Step-by-step explanation:

The zeros of a function are the values of x for which the value of the function f(x) becomes zero.

In this problem, we have the following function:

f(x)=\frac{1}{2}(x-1)(x+3)

Here we want to find the zeros of the function, i.e. the values of x for which

f(x)=0

In order to make f(x) equal to zero, either one of the factors (x-1) or (x+3) must be equal to zero.

Therefore, the two zeros can be found by requiring that:

1)

x-1=0\\\rightarrow x=+1

2)

x+3=0\\\rightarrow x=-3

So the correct options are

a:x=-3

c:x=1

A regular pentagon has an apothem of 7.3 inches and a perimeter of 53 inches. What is the area of the pentagon? Round your answe

Answer:

Area pf the regular pentagon is 193inch^{2} to the nearest whole number

Step-by-step explanation:

In this question, we are tasked with calculating the area of a regular pentagon, given the apothem and the perimeter

Mathematically, the area of a regular pentagon given the apothem and the perimeter can be calculated using the formula below;

Area of regular pentagon = 1/2 × apothem × perimeter

From the question, we can identify that the value of the apothem is 7.3 inches, while the value of the perimeter is 53 inches

We plug these values into the equation above to get;

Area = 1/2 × 7.3× 53 = 386.9/2 = 193.45 which is 193inch^{2} to the nearest whole number
